Originally published as 24 newspaper columns from 1859 to 1861 Mrs. Beetons Book of Household Management was at first a guide to managing a household. Today it is a fascinating look at the past and a guide to forgotten skills that can be used today. Beeton wrote As with the commander of an army or the leader of any enterprise so is it with the mistress of a house. Running an extravagant household was a monumental task and a responsibility not to be taken lightly. It meant supervising every employee from the butler to the laundry-maid to the footman and the wet nurse. It meant managing the safety happiness comfort and well-being of the family. Chapters include: The Housekeeper Arrangement and Economy of the Kitchen Introduction to Cooker General Directions for Making Soup Recipes: Fish Recipes: Pork and Ham Recipes: Poultry and Rabbit And much more! In addition to offering advice on a wide range of domestic topics this abridged edition of Mrs. Beetons Book of Household Management contains hundreds of original recipes. A compendium of practical information about everything from animal husbandry to child care this Victorian classic is both fascinating and still useful. Sarah A. Chrisman author of Victorian Secrets and This Victorian Life provides the foreword reflecting on how she uses Mrs. Beetons advice on a daily basis.
